    Beaver Crick:
    A remake of Beaver Creek

    Aspects:
    Accurate weapon placement
    Two Bases
    Creek & bridge
    Two-Way Teleporters
    Set up to play as slayer, assault, and CTF

    Description:

    Hello to all fellow forgers. I have just finished my first remake map. It is a replica done from memory but I'm sure you will find it extremely accurate. Being my first remake and my first real map (interlocking and such) I'm extremely proud of it. You may notice that I neglected to add the basements or that the bases aren't exactly symmetrical, but even with the use of the infinite budget some things just can't be done.


    I spent about a week working on this(about an hour a day) with my brother. Please leave me comments and criticism as I'm a fairly new forger and would love to know what everyone thinks so I can improve my skills and make even better maps in the future.
